Abstract
The article dwells on important aspects of the development of the modern information society in the context of implementation of constitutional values. The recognition of a person, his rights and freedoms as the highest value of a democratic state acts as a condition for the development of a legal system focused on ensuring freedom of information. This aspect of the information society implies not only free dissemination of information, but also the openness and transparency of the public administration system transformed under the influence of information and communication technologies. Constitutional values act as an axiological basis for the legal development of the state, contributing to the improvement of public administration and realization of fundamental rights and freedoms of the individual. Based on the analysis of the value apparatus of the constitutional law, the conclusion is made about freedom of information as an integral condition for the development of civil society. Current trends in the development of modern society are distinguished, first of all, by the increasing importance of the process of digitalization and informatization of various aspects of human social life. The information sphere is becoming the most important resource of power and management; information technologies are increasingly being introduced not only into all spheres of public administration, but also into the spheres of life of the whole society, and the state should stimulate such processes.
